Olu is an accomplished civil engineer, mathematical modeller and one of world's foremost accessibility modellers. Specialising in infrastructure planning, accessibility planning/modelling, transportation planning/modelling, local and national policy development/implementation and software engineering. Olu has the ability to solve complex technical problems and think out of the box in finding novel and ingenious solutions to some of the world's most demanding engineering, professional and research challenges.

Olu for example wrote the UK Government's technical guidance on accessibility planning and co-authored the UK Government's wider policy guidance on accessibility planning, developed the national core and composite accessibility indicators underpinning accessibility planning in England, and which form the basis for a number of the transport elements of the UK Government's emerging performance management framework for local government, amongst other contributions.

Olu's various contributions to the development of accessibility planning in England are believed to have improved and increased spatial planning, accessibility and transport planning, modelling and assessment capabilities within the UK and increasingly internationally.
